pinctrl: remove all usage of gpio_remove ret val in driver/pinctl
[linux-2.6-block.git] / drivers / pinctrl / sunxi / pinctrl-sunxi.c
index 47f5e1bc50d07203927bf4664f23ce66c962f3fe..96ee6bb0fad581b35d28e7e97f806b00346f5482 100644 (file)
@@ -983,8 +983,7 @@ int sunxi_pinctrl_init(struct platform_device *pdev,
 clk_error:
        clk_disable_unprepare(clk);
 gpiochip_error:
-       if (gpiochip_remove(pctl->chip))
-               dev_err(&pdev->dev, "failed to remove gpio chip\n");
+       gpiochip_remove(pctl->chip);
 pinctrl_error:
        pinctrl_unregister(pctl->pctl_dev);
        return ret;